A CHARLIE BROWN CHRISTMAS Comes to the Secret Theatre

Secret Theatre presents A Charlie Brown Christmas by Charles M. Schulz, based on the television special by Bill Melendez
and Lee Mendelson. Stage Adaptation by Eric Schaeffer, by Special Arrangement with Arthur Whitelaw and Ruby Persson.

The classic animated television special A CHARLIE BROWN CHRISTMAS comes to life in this faithful stage adaptation, in which Charlie Brown, Snoopy, and the rest of the Peanuts Gang discover the true meaning of Christmas.

Back by popular demand this the third year running that the Secret has brought this family-friendly holiday musical to kids of all ages.

When Charlie Brown complains about the overwhelming materialism he sees among everyone during the Christmas season, Lucy suggests that he become director of the school Christmas pageant. Charlie Brown accepts, but this proves to be a frustrating endeavor. When an attempt to restore the proper holiday spirit with a forlorn little Christmas fir tree fails, he needs Linus' help to discover the real meaning of Christmas.

Featuring the song Christmas Time is Here, the music of jazz artist Vince Guaraldi who scored the original animation this is a joyous, heartwarming musical for the season.
